What is Portainer CE?

Portainer CE (Community Edition) is a lightweight, open-source management platform for Docker, Swarm, and Kubernetes environments. It provides a intuitive web interface for users to easily manage their containerized applications, including deployment, scaling, and monitoring. With Portainer CE, users can simplify the process of container orchestration, reducing the complexity and administrative overhead associated with managing containerized environments.

Portainer CE is designed to be highly customizable and extensible, with a modular architecture that allows users to easily add or remove features as needed. This flexibility makes it an ideal solution for a wide range of use cases, from small development environments to large-scale production deployments.

Key Features

Orchestration and Deployment

Portainer CE provides a comprehensive set of features for deploying and managing containerized applications. Users can easily create, update, and delete containers, as well as manage their configuration and networking settings. The platform also supports rolling updates, allowing users to update their applications with minimal downtime.

Monitoring and Logging

Portainer CE includes built-in monitoring and logging capabilities, providing users with real-time visibility into their containerized environments. Users can monitor CPU, memory, and network usage, as well as view logs from their containers. This allows for quick identification and resolution of issues, reducing downtime and improving overall system reliability.

Security and Access Control

Portainer CE takes security seriously, with a range of features to ensure that containerized environments are secure and compliant. Users can create custom roles and permissions, controlling access to sensitive resources and data. The platform also supports encryption and secure authentication protocols, ensuring that data is protected both in transit and at rest.

Installation Guide

Prerequisites

Before installing Portainer CE, users will need to ensure that their environment meets the minimum system requirements. This includes a compatible version of Docker, as well as sufficient CPU, memory, and storage resources.

Installation Options

Portainer CE can be installed using a variety of methods, including Docker Compose, Helm, and binary installation. Users can choose the method that best fits their needs, depending on their environment and deployment requirements.

Post-Installation Configuration

After installation, users will need to configure Portainer CE to meet their specific needs. This includes setting up authentication and authorization, as well as configuring any additional features or plugins.

Technical Specifications

System Requirements

Portainer CE is compatible with a range of operating systems, including Linux, Windows, and macOS. The platform also supports a variety of Docker versions, ensuring that users can deploy and manage their containerized applications with confidence.

Supported Features

Portainer CE supports a wide range of features, including container orchestration, deployment, monitoring, and logging. The platform also includes built-in support for Docker Swarm and Kubernetes, making it easy to manage complex containerized environments.

Pros and Cons

Advantages

Portainer CE offers a range of advantages, including ease of use, flexibility, and scalability. The platform is highly customizable, making it an ideal solution for a wide range of use cases. Additionally, Portainer CE is open-source, ensuring that users have access to a community-driven platform with a strong focus on security and reliability.

Disadvantages

While Portainer CE offers many advantages, there are some potential disadvantages to consider. For example, the platform may require additional configuration and setup, particularly for complex environments. Additionally, users may need to invest time and resources into learning the platform and its features.

FAQ

What is Portainer CE used for?

Portainer CE is used for managing containerized applications, including deployment, scaling, and monitoring.

Is Portainer CE free?

Yes, Portainer CE is free and open-source, making it an ideal solution for users who want to manage their containerized environments without incurring significant costs.

Can I use Portainer CE with other container orchestration tools?

Yes, Portainer CE supports a range of container orchestration tools, including Docker Swarm and Kubernetes.

Submit your application